Now my problem: I have several plasma applets that uses qtimer to schedule updates. These updates are then screwed up because of system suspends (I close the lid of my laptop). So I can see two possible solutions: 1) a signal that informs about a resume from suspend/standby (I tried to use the powersave plasma dataengine which have state variables, but they are not updated during suspend/resume events) 2) using brute force by checking the system time in intervals (such as every minute). In a plasma event this would mean connecting to the time dataengine and compare my scheduled time with the current.
